The Access Control as a Service (ACaaS) market in Morocco is experiencing steady growth due to increasing awareness of the importance of security in various sectors such as government, healthcare, and retail. ACaaS solutions offer flexibility, scalability, and cost-effectiveness, making them attractive to businesses looking to enhance their security measures without heavy upfront investments. The market is witnessing a shift towards cloud-based ACaaS solutions as they offer remote management capabilities and seamless integration with other security systems. Key players in the Morocco ACaaS market include international companies expanding their presence in the region, as well as local providers offering customized solutions to meet the specific needs of Moroccan businesses. With the increasing trend towards digitalization and IoT integration, the ACaaS market in Morocco is expected to continue its growth trajectory in the coming years.

In the Morocco Access Control as a Service market, one of the main challenges faced is the lack of awareness and understanding among businesses regarding the benefits and functionalities of cloud-based access control solutions. Many organizations in Morocco still rely on traditional, on-premise access control systems and are hesitant to transition to a cloud-based model due to concerns about data security and reliability. Additionally, the relatively slow adoption of advanced technologies in the region poses a challenge for service providers looking to penetrate the market with innovative access control solutions. To overcome these challenges, companies operating in the Morocco Access Control as a Service market need to focus on educating potential customers about the advantages of cloud-based access control, addressing data security concerns, and showcasing successful case studies to demonstrate the effectiveness of these solutions.

In Morocco, the government has implemented policies to encourage the adoption of Access Control as a Service (ACaaS) solutions in various sectors. These policies focus on data protection, cybersecurity, and privacy regulations to ensure the secure implementation and operation of ACaaS systems. Additionally, the government has initiatives to promote digital transformation and the use of innovative technologies, including ACaaS, to enhance overall security measures in public and private institutions. Furthermore, there are regulations in place to govern the access control industry, ensuring compliance with standards and best practices to safeguard sensitive information and assets. Overall, the government`s policies aim to create a conducive environment for the growth of the ACaaS market while prioritizing security and data protection considerations.
